Forwarded from Al Nassr FC
Trolling aside, @Hilal_Al genuinely impressed at the FIFA Club World Cup. They competed with heart and discipline in every match, even while missing key players due to injury.
Their performance wasn’t just respectable, it was a statement.
Their showing highlighted the growing quality and ambition within the Saudi Pro League.
It’s no longer just about big-name signings, teams are being built with structure, depth, and a real competitive edge.
The league’s progress is undeniable, and performances like this only reinforce its rising status in world football.
